Wycaro is science fiction television series created by showrunner Vince Gilligan. The series stars Rhea Seehorn. Apple ordered two seasons of the series for its streaming service Apple TV+.

Premise

The series is set in a present-day Albuquerque, New Mexico that faced an abrupt change away from the world as it is known.[1]

Production

After finishing Better Call Saul, Vince Gilligan pitched a new series that he would develop in August 2022 with Sony Pictures Television.[2] The following month, Apple TV+ won the rights to the show, giving it a two-season order. Gilligan serves as showrunner and executive producer, and Rhea Seahorn was cast in the lead role.[3]

Writing for the first season was interrupted by the 2023 WGA strike, but Gilligan and his writers' room regrouped in October 2023 to finish the last two episodes. The strike also pushed back the plans to begin shooting, possibly into the cold winter in Albuquerque, New Mexico.[1] In March 2024, Karolina Wydra was cast in the series as well.[4]

Filming ultimately began on the series by May 2024,[5] and is currently set to finish in September 2024 after 4 months of production in Albuquerque, New Mexico under the possible codename Wycaro 339.[6]
